The pricing at Vintage Cafè is generally perceived as fair and competitive for its central Florence location, reflecting the quality of products and the pleasant atmosphere provided.
525
4030
Espresso€1.80
Cappuccino€3.50
Cornetto (Croissant)€2.00
Aperol Spritz€9.00

Peak hours are typically mornings (8:00 AM – 11:00 AM) for coffee and pastries, and evenings (6:00 PM – 8:00 PM) for aperitivo. Weekends are generally busier throughout the day.Seating can be limited, especially during peak times. It’s primarily a smaller, cozy space, so larger groups might find it challenging to sit together without a wait.
Generally moderate. It can be lively and bustling during busy periods but typically maintains a comfortable conversational level.Staff primarily speak Italian and English, with some understanding of other common tourist languages.
Free Wi-Fi is available for guests, making it suitable for quick work or browsing.No dedicated parking. Street parking in the area is extremely limited and often restricted. Public garages are available a short walk away.
The entrance is generally accessible, but the interior might have limited space for wheelchairs due to its cozy layout. Restrooms may not be fully accessible.Located in a historic and vibrant part of Florence, close to major attractions like the Duomo and Mercato Centrale, surrounded by shops and other eateries.
